Yoghurt,both plain and with cucumbers,is a staple of Iranian tables – the thicker and sourer,the better. As a kid,I used yoghurt not only to balance sweetness and richness,but also to cool down food that was too hot to eat. Mast-o khiar is an everyday side,and one of my favourites. Dice,rather than grate,the cucumbers to keep them from getting watery,and don't skip the dried herbs,which add dimension to the fresh herbs.
